If you want a smaller Utah ski area with an easygoing, welcoming atmosphere and prices that don’t sting, Nordic Valley Ski Resort is a sweet spot. Set in upper Ogden Valley near Eden, Nordic Valley blends approachable beginner zones with fun laps for confident riders.
It offers excellent night skiing and one of the state’s strongest learn-to-ski programs. The mountain lists 1,700 feet of vertical, 40 runs, five lifts, and a base around 5,365 feet. There’s plenty to explore without the stress of mega-resort crowds.
The headline upgrade is Nordic Express, a high-speed chair. It doubled the skiable acres, raised the top elevation to about 7,060 feet, and added 20 new runs.
This is a huge jump for this local favorite. The result is more acres of terrain, faster laps, and better flow across the mountain.

From I-15, slide through Ogden and drive up the canyon on UT-39E. The road is straightforward and less intimidating than steeper canyon drives, even on stormy days.
It’s about 30 minutes (16 miles) up the canyon. Punch in “3567 Nordic Valley Way, Eden, UT 84310” for the lot closest to rentals and tickets.

This is one of Utah’s best night skiing values. Many operating days run into the evening.
You can grab a few hours after work or make it a family night with cocoa breaks in the lodge. Check the current calendar for lit terrain and times.
Nordic Valley leans into value. Lift tickets are dynamic online, with promo windows that can start surprisingly low if you buy early.
If you’ll ski for several days, consider a season pass through the Power Pass. Perks can include discounted buddy tickets and food/retail savings.
Lesson options span budget group lessons to customizable private lessons. Book ahead for weekends and holidays.

On-mountain food is grab-and-go comfort, which is precisely what you want between laps. For a broader scene, base in Ogden (historic 25th Street dining, breweries)
Or stay close in Eden/Huntsville for quiet nights near Snowbasin Resort and Pineview Reservoir. You’ll find national-brand hotels in Ogden and vacation rentals scattered across the valley.

Nordic Valley traces its roots to the late 1960s/early 1970s. You might still hear the name “Wolf Mountain” from old-timers, which was its original name.
The 2020 Nordic Express expansion marked the most significant leap in decades, signaling fresh investment while preserving the homegrown feel locals love.
